24小时热门版块排行榜    

查看: 1209  |  回复: 13
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

199821756

铁虫 (初入文坛)

[求助] 大虾们过来给我个算法指示吧!牛的都来看看C/C++已有6人参与

一个圆,分为16384个点,,知道你所在的点 和目标点,,你如何通过算法逻辑判断 到底是顺时针过去近,还是逆时针近。当然一样距离2算顺时针近。
说下你认为最简单合理的方法 谢谢了!我脑袋都想炸了!!
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

yangjunjuan

铜虫 (初入文坛)

【答案】应助回帖

感谢参与,应助指数 +1
可否知道目标点沿顺时针方向的等差目标前一点(s1)和目标点的后一点(s2)呢,如果知道的话可以计算当前点(o)与目标点的前一点与后一点的距离,并进行比较,若o与s1的距离大于o与s2的距离则采用逆时针方向,否则采用顺时针方向
5楼2014-04-27 11:13:04
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 199821756 的主题更新
信息提示
请填处理意见